Commercial landscaping services involve the design, installation, and maintenance of outdoor spaces for various types of properties. These services typically include lawn care, planting beds, tree trimming, irrigation system setup, and hardscape features like walkways and patios. The goal is to create attractive, functional outdoor environments that enhance the property's appearance and usability. Whether for office complexes, retail centers, industrial parks, or municipal facilities, professional landscapers help ensure outdoor areas are well-kept and inviting.
Many property owners turn to commercial landscaping to address common problems such as overgrown grass, neglected plantings, and inefficient irrigation systems. Poorly maintained landscapes can negatively impact curb appeal and may even lead to safety hazards like uneven walkways or tripping risks. Service providers can help solve these issues by providing regular upkeep, pruning, and repairs that keep outdoor spaces safe and visually appealing. Additionally, they can assist with seasonal cleanups and landscape enhancements to adapt the property’s appearance throughout the year.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Landscaping proj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in La Crosse,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ine landscaping repairs, such as fixing sprinkler systems or replacing small plantings, generally range from $250 to $600. Many projects fall within this middle range, with fewer jobs reaching higher prices for more extensive fixes.
Mid-Size Landscaping Projects - Larger enhancements like installing new lawns, planting beds, or outdoor lighting usually cost between $1,000 and $3,500. Most local contractors handle projects in this range, though more complex designs can push costs higher.
Full Landscape Installations - Complete landscape overhauls, including grading, hardscaping, and extensive plantings, often range from $5,000 to $15,000. These projects are less common and tend to involve detailed planning and larger crews.
Large Commercial Landscaping - For sizable commercial properties requiring extensive redesigns, irrigation, or large-scale planting, costs can start around $20,000 and may exceed $50,000. Such projects are typically more complex and less frequent than smaller-scale jobs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Clear, written expectations are essential when choosing a landscaping contractor. This includes detailed descriptions of the work to be performed, the materials to be used, and the overall scope of the project. Well-defined expectations help ensure that both parties are aligned and can reduce misunderstandings. Service providers who provide comprehensive written proposals or contracts demonstrate professionalism and transparency, making it easier to compare options and select a contractor that meets the specific needs of the property.
